Paste-aggregate Separation Process Rewrites Demolition Concrete Recycling

Sources: Fives FCB, Villeneuve d’Ascq, France; CO staff

Identifying optimal grinding kinetics and compressive force trajectories for up to 5-in. demolition concrete feeds, global mineral process equipment specialist Fives FCB attains economical separation of cement paste from sand and gravel or rock. In one to three cycles or material passes, the FCB Rhodax 4D inertial vibrating cone grinder nets cement paste powder at a purity level sufficient to use as a significant replacement for virgin raw materials in cement kiln raw mix (subject mostly to chemistry) or Portland cement in concrete mix designs. The grinder also delivers fine and coarse aggregates with cubicity and water demand characteristics suiting new concrete mixes.

The Construction & Demolition Recycling Association’s 2025 C&D World Conference and Exhibition in Texas saw a North American market debut of the FCB Rhodax 4D-based process. Fives FCB team members showed how the equipment literally liberates three recyclable concrete components by applying an in bed constant compressive force to generate fractures at the most fragile points along the interface between hydrated cement and fine or coarse aggregate. In conventional demolition concrete crushing, by contrast, the cracks are typically generated at the point of impact – resulting only in feed material size reduction. 

The FCB Rhodax 4D crusher is composed of a grinding chamber that is set in motion and a central cone free in rotation. The material is compressed in between, while the gap between the chamber and the cone allows an adjustment of the maximal outlet particle size. The 4D nomenclature refers to four motorized, unbalanced masses that bring constant compressive force by driving the chamber horizontally in circular motion. The chamber’s eccentric orientation facilitates compression on one side and material segregation or downward movement on the other.

Fives FCB brought the demolition concrete recycling concept to the mid-March C&D World event following four FCB Rhodax 4D delivery commitments in Europe and Taiwan during 2024 and 2025, the first to a Heidelberg Materials site in Poland.
